Foreword / by India Hicks -- Introduction -- The designer's eye -- Botanicals through the ages -- Designing with floral textiles -- Antique textiles -- Using colours from nature -- Introducing natural textiles -- Working with flowers and greenery
"Stunning botanically inspired interiors from chintz to chinoiserie. For Charlotte Coote, the interiors that have stayed with her are those that feel confident and unashamed. Charlotte's bold and contemporary spaces embrace beauty and authenticity and transcend modern trends. Modern Floral offers an abundance of inspiration on how to bring the colors, patterns, and textures of nature into your home. From designing with floral and antique textiles to color concepts and ideas for incorporating natural textures, this book demonstrates the endless inspiration that comes from the timelessness and elegance of nature. With mood boards, hand-drawn illustrations, and step-by-step guides, Coote shows that drawing on the natural world is always a strong and grounding foundation from which to create."--Publisher's website
